Course overview

This programme is aimed at students who have completed a Level 3 course in Compiting, IT or a related subject, who are looking to study a Higher Education programme locally to progress their career within this sector.

Please note that students without the formal entry criteria but with relevant experience will also be considered.

What will I learn

You will study five core modules:
• Computing project
• Database design and implementation
• Networking security
• Programming and software development
• The computing professional
Then you will select an additional one module from the following options:
• Computer systems architecture
• Website and e-commerce development
• Data analytics

How will the courses be assessed?

A series of written and practical work is assessed by your tutors and will determine your overall grade.

Entry requirements

Minimum 48 UCAS Tariff points, with the majority obtained from relevant subjects.

GCSE English or equivalent.

Applicants without formal entry qualifications but with relevant work experience will be considered for entry to the programme subject to an interview and appropriate diagnostic tests.

Progression

Completion of the HNC Computing provides a valuable vocational qualification to enhance students' career prospects, and provides progression to the FdSc Computing.
